Web29 okt. 2024 · A bruise occurs when an injury is strong enough to cause small blood vessels to leak or tear under the skin. Soon after an injury, there may be some redness and swelling of the area. This is the stage when blood and fluid are moving into the tissue (icing the area can help slow down this process). Web14 okt. 2024 · Aging – Bruises known as actinic purpura are found at the back of the arms and hands in older people. It happens when blood vessels become weak due to repeated exposure to the sun. They first appear as flat red blotches and change color to purple, become deeper before they gradually fade away. Web17 mei 2024 · There could be other underlying causes for frequent bruising, but it’s likely not caused by diabetes. What your husband may be referring to is acanthosis nigricans, a condition in which the skin surrounding folds and creases become thick and dark. This condition has been correlated to the development of type 2 diabetes.
